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Caddo Valley's airport?
Caddo Valley is served by just one airport, Memorial Field Airport (HOT).
How far is Memorial Field Airport (HOT) from central Caddo Valley?
Memorial Field Airport is 32 kilometres from downtown Caddo Valley, so expect a bit of a journey into the centre of the city.
What airport is best to fly into Caddo Valley?
Travellers from all over the place pass through Memorial Field Airport every day. Hop off the plane, pick up your bags and you’ll be 32 kilometres from the heart of Caddo Valley.
How many airlines fly to Caddo Valley?
You won’t have any trouble choosing who you’ll fly to Caddo Valley with — just one airline services the route. Book in advance to make sure you can fly on your preferred dates.
Which airlines fly to Caddo Valley?
Southern Airways Express operates a large amount of flights to Caddo Valley. Grabbing a Southern Airways Express flight from Dallas is the preferred way of getting there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Caddo Valley?
Organising an unforgettable Caddo Valley adventure is simple when there are 18 direct flights each week to choose from.
Where are the most popular flights to Caddo Valley departing from?
While people fly from every corner of the globe to visit Caddo Valley, the most popular flights depart from Dallas and Memphis.
How long is the flight to Caddo Valley Airport?
Flights from Dallas to Caddo Valley typically take 1 hour and 45 minutes. Or you could depart from Memphis instead, which would mean you’ll be airborne for roughly 1 hour and 15 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Caddo Valley?
No matter where you’re coming from, flying can be a seamless experience if you’ve prepared well enough. Check out these handy tips that will get your Caddo Valley escape started on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• It’s easy — first, pack your passport, travel docs, wallet and vital medications. Next, you’ll want some extra in-flight entertainment to while away the time. A juicy book and a laptop filled with your favourite shows are some fantastic options. If you hope to take a short snooze, a comfy neck pillow and some earplugs will also come in handy. Finally, make room for a toothbrush and some deodorant so you’ll arrive at your destination looking fresh and raring to go.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Squeeze all your full-sized bottles of hair gel and hairspray in your checked baggage. Any liquids in your carry-on bag lar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by security. Sharp objects, like your trusty Swiss Army knife, and dangerous products which are explosive or flammable, such as flares, bleaching agents and poisons, are also restricted.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your aim here is to feel as comfortable as you can. Dress in loose, natural-fibre clothing and bring a jacket in case it gets cool in the cabin. Go for a pair of flat, well-fitting shoes as it’s possible that your feet and ankles will swell a little during the flight. Leave the stilettos and heavy boots in your main luggage.
  • The condition known as D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-distance flights. It’s the result of blood clots forming due to inactivity and poor circulation. Doing regular fo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this from occurring. Wearing a quality pair of compression socks or tights can also help.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Caddo Valley?
As savvy travellers know, the secret is to be well organised before you reach security. That way, you’ll be hopping onto that plane to Caddo Valley before you know it. Follow these helpful tips and get your holiday off to a flying start:

  • Airport security personnel first need to see that you have a valid passport and travel documents before you can proceed any further. Keep them close by.
  • Your jacket, belt, keys and other contents of your pockets, like your headphones, will need to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as it gets closer to your turn.
  • For just a few minutes, you’ll need to unplug from technology. Your tablet, phone and any other electronic gadgets must also go through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as perfume or toothpaste, that you want to take on board must be no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• It’s also likely that you’ll be asked to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a clever idea.
  • Airlines won’t allow any pocket knives or other sharp items in the cabin. If you need to b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ked baggage.
